Open SB2. Open the map you want. You should have a 'rollup bar' on the right hand side. (if not go to View>Show Rollup Bar) Then click on Entity>Items (in the browser section) and then select the sniper scope and drag and drop into the map.

Ok, i forgot to mention this  . After you save the file, go to File>export to engine, or press CTRL+E. That should work now.  )

I think it should work starting the map from the beginning. If you cant access that for some reason, open crysis and type in console, 'con_restricted 0' and then 'map Island' (or maybe its 'map_island'). do these without the '' of course. Good thinking with the backup as well!
